Owner’s Responsibility

Customer Assistance

1.Before operating your Supra, it is necessary to read and fully understand this Owner’s Manual and all other information delivered with the boat.

2.It is the owner’s responsibility to take the boat to an authorized Supra dealer to obtain warranty service.

3.It is the owner’s responsibility to properly operate and maintain the boat in accordance with this manual and all other information delivered with boat.

4.The owner should keep maintenance records should it be necessary to show that required maintenance has been performed on the boat.

Dealer’s Responsibility

1.The Dealer should provide the buyer with an adequate orientation in the general operation of the boat and review all systems and accessories included with the boat.

2.The Dealer should deliver a complete owner’s manual packet with the boat consisting of Owner’s Manual, Registration Engine Manual, Stereo Manual, Supra Warranty and all warranties for separately warranted items aboard the boat.

3.The Dealer should review all warranty information with the buyer and assist in filling out warranty cards if necessary.

4.The Dealer should insure that any information or obligation from either Skier’s Choice, Inc. or from the dealership is clearly understood by the buyer.

5.The Dealer should instruct the buyer in obtaining local service and out-of-area service for a Supra boat.

The staff at Skier’s Choice, Inc. is concerned with your complete satisfaction. This includes the prompt resolution of any problems that may arise during the warranty period. Normally, problems encountered may be efficiently and effectively resolved by your Supra Dealer. However, if a problem cannot be handled by the Dealer or if a solution is not satisfactory to you as an Owner, please follow these steps to get the matter resolved:

STEP ONE

Discuss the problem with a member of your Supra Dealer’s management staff. It is most likely that the problem will be resolved at this level.

STEP TWO

If the Dealer management does not resolve the problem to your satisfaction, please have the problem and all action taken, documented by the Dealer, then contact the factory Customer Service Representative at Skier’s Choice, Inc.:

Describe the original problem in detail to the Customer Service Representative. Be prepared to furnish appropriate documentation and the reasons why service by the Dealer was unsatisfactory. If further action is required to resolve the problem, the Customer Service Representative will dictate the appropriate action.

STEP THREE

Finally, if after following these steps and providing documentation and after obtaining necessary authorization from the Customer Service Representative to take additional action, the problem is still not resolved to your satisfaction, the President of Skier’s Choice, Inc. will personally review the problem and make a determination concerning final resolution.
